I'm doing a blackjack simulation, and im trying to store data such as the amount of player 1 wins, player 2 wins and draws (listed in code below)from each time the simulation is run into a file elsewhere (csv file) and and im also trying to perform statistical analysis like, the most common card number picked, the mean card number picked, .the most common suit picked. What would be the solution to this? here is my code

import random import statistics

Mode = input("Would you like to play singleplayer(1), multplayer(2) or do a simulation(3).(Type number): ")

elif Mode == "3": def dealCard(hand, deck): card = random.choice(deck) hand.append(card) deck.remove(card)

def total(hand): total = 0 ace_11s = 0 for card in hand: if card in range(2, 11): total += card elif card in ["J", "K", "Q"]: total += 10 else: total += 11 ace_11s += 1 while ace_11s and total > 21: total -= 10 ace_11s -= 1 return total

def simulate_game(): deck = [2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10,"J", "Q", "K", "A", "J", "Q", "K", "A", "J", "Q", "K", "A", "J", "Q", "K", "A"] random.shuffle(deck) player1Hand = [] player2Hand = [] dealerHand = [] dealCard(player1Hand, deck) dealCard(player2Hand, deck) dealCard(dealerHand, deck) dealCard(player1Hand, deck) dealCard(player2Hand, deck) dealCard(dealerHand, deck) player1St = True player2St = True dealerSt = True while player1St or player2St or dealerSt: print(f"Dealer has {dealerHand[0]} and X") print(f"Player 1 has {player1Hand} for a total of {total(player1Hand)} ") print(f"Player 2 has {player2Hand} for a total of {total(player2Hand)} ") if player1St: if total(player1Hand) > 21: player1St = False else: if total(dealerHand) > 16: dealerSt = False else: dealCard(dealerHand, deck) if total(player1Hand) >= 17: player1St = False else: dealCard(player1Hand, deck) if player2St: if total(player2Hand) > 21: player2St = False else: if total(dealerHand) > 16: dealerSt = False else: dealCard(dealerHand, deck) if total(player2Hand) >= 17: player2St = False else: dealCard(player2Hand, deck) if total(dealerHand) > 21: dealerSt = False elif total(dealerHand) >= 17: dealerSt = False if total(player1Hand) > 21: result = "Player 2" elif total(player2Hand) > 21: result = "Player 1" elif total(player1Hand) == total(player2Hand): result = "Draw" elif total(player1Hand) > total(player2Hand): result = "Player 1" else: result = "Player 2" return result

num_games = int(input("How many times will we run this simulation?: ")) results = {"Player 1": 0, "Player 2": 0, "Draw": 0}

for i in range(num_games): result = simulate_game() results[result] += 1

print(f"Player 1 won {results['Player 1']} times.") print(f"Player 2 won {results['Player 2']} times.") print(f"There were {results['Draw']} draws.")
